SCHNEIDER EXPECTED TO TURN PRO

VictoriaTimes said:

The wildcard is Cory Schneider, the highly-touted American goaltender the Canucks drafted 26th overall in the first round in 2004.

Schneider, a college senior, is expected to turn pro and join either Manitoba or Victoria immediately after his NCAA career ends this spring with Hockey East-champion Boston College.

The Eagles could be eliminated as early as this weekend in the NCAA Northeast regionals, or not until after the 2007 Frozen Four semifinals April 5 or final April 7 in St. Louis.

"There are a lot of variables at play, including Schneider, in this [Manitoba-Victoria goaltending] situation," said Belisle.

http://www.canada.co...a1-e6770dc0e755



So ummm.... facts checker?

He's a college junior.

Absolutely no quote specifying that he will turn pro, only some guy saying there's variables.

It is very unlikely that he will turn pro before the semester ends. Especially since BC is a favourite to be in the Frozen Four which would only leave a few weeks of school left at most. (unless they have a different timeframe for semesters there.)

"The Manitoba Moose, the AHL affiliate of the Vancouver Canucks, announced they recalled goaltender Julien Ellis from the Victoria Salmon Kings of the ECHL.  

Ellis, 21, has appeared in six games with the Moose so far in his first season of professional hockey. He has compiled a record of 0-6-0 with a goals against average of 3.71 and a save percentage of .885. He has also appeared in 34 games this year with the Salmon Kings where he is 18-14-2 with a 3.31 goals against average and a .910 save percentage and was named to the ECHL All-Star Game.  

Ellis was originally drafted by the Vancouver Canucks with their sixth choice, 189th overall, in the 2004 NHL Entry Draft.
